A practical social media content marketing approach usually includes:

  • Content planning and scheduling: a publishing calendar tailored for your audience.  
  • Posting consistency: regular posts across the right platforms (Instagram, Facebook, TikTok, LinkedIn, etc.).  
  • Engagement management: replying to comments, DMs, and community interactions.  
  • Creative content creation: imagery, short videos, stories, reels, and carousel posts that tell your brand story.  
  • Conversion optimisation: CTAs, link placement, and campaign-level goals built into every post.  
  • Reporting and insights: tracking engagement, reach, follower growth, and outcomes that tie back to leads and sales.

Common Mistakes Small Businesses Make With Social media content marketing

Most issues aren’t because social media can’t deliver. When social media feels loud or forced, it usually stops working. Trust grows when an account feels steady and intentional, not reactive. They usually happen because:

  • Posting without a plan  
  • Inconsistent schedules and engagement gaps  
  • No clear goals for conversions  
  • Ignoring community replies and DMs  
  • Focusing on likes instead of outcomes
